Lamb Loin (Cooked)

Lamb, loin, separable lean and fat, trimmed to 1/4" fat, choice, cooked, broiled

Per 100g, Lamb Loin (Cooked) has 316 calories, 25.2g protein, 0g carbs, and 23.1g fat.

Lamb Loin (Cooked) has 316 calories per 100g with 25.2g of protein, 0g of carbohydrates, 23.1g of fat. It's a solid protein source and a good source of potassium. It is also high in saturated fat with 9.83g per 100g, which is worth watching if you are managing heart health or cholesterol.
